Escribir SQL solía significar memorizar peculiaridades de dialecto, buscar entre la documentación de esquemas y reescribir joins cada vez que un stakeholder hacía una nueva pregunta. Hoy, las mejores herramientas de IA para consultas SQL permiten a analistas y usuarios de negocio describir lo que quieren en lenguaje natural y obtener SQL ejecutable y, a menudo, optimizado. Según la documentación del proyecto PostgreSQL y el análisis de la industria sobre analítica de datos más amplio, las interfaces en lenguaje natural ya son una capa estándar en los stacks de datos modernos, no una novedad.
Cómo ayuda la IA con las consultas SQL
Los asistentes modernos de IA para SQL hacen mucho más que autocompletar un SELECT. Interpretan la intención del usuario, la asignan a las tablas y columnas correctas usando el esquema en vivo y producen SQL correcto para el dialecto en almacenes de datos como BigQuery, Snowflake, Postgres o MySQL. Muchas herramientas pueden explicar la consulta generada, corregir errores de sintaxis sobre la marcha, sugerir índices y proponer preguntas de seguimiento que el usuario podría querer hacer a continuación.
Para los equipos, esto reduce el viaje de ida y vuelta entre una pregunta de negocio y una respuesta basada en datos. Un responsable de marketing puede preguntar «cuál fue la tasa de conversión por canal el último trimestre» y obtener tanto la consulta como un gráfico sin abrir un ticket. Al mismo tiempo, los ingenieros usan estas herramientas para generar boilerplate, refactorizar CTEs desordenados y documentar SQL heredado, ahorrando horas cada semana.
Qué buscar
Soporte de dialecto y almacén de datos
SQL no es un único lenguaje. La herramienta adecuada debería soportar tu dialecto específico — BigQuery, Snowflake, Postgres, MySQL, SQL Server o DuckDB — y, a ser posible, permitirte cambiar sin tener que reaprender prompts. Las herramientas estrechamente vinculadas a un único almacén suelen generar SQL mejor y más idiomático para ese entorno.
Conciencia del esquema
Una buena herramienta de IA para SQL lee tu esquema en vivo, incluidos los tipos de columna, las claves foráneas y las descripciones de tablas, para generar joins que realmente existen. Las herramientas genéricas entrenadas solo con datos públicos inventarán tablas; las herramientas listas para producción te permiten conectar una base de datos real o subir DDL de muestra para obtener resultados fundamentados.
Transparencia y explicabilidad
Busca herramientas que muestren la consulta generada, expliquen la lógica en lenguaje natural y te permitan editarla antes de ejecutarla. La confianza importa: los analistas necesitan verificar joins y filtros antes de enviar cifras a la dirección, y los equipos de gobernanza exigen cada vez más registros de auditoría.
Integraciones y encaje en el flujo de trabajo
Piensa dónde trabajas realmente. Las mejores opciones se integran en entornos de notebooks, plataformas de BI como Metabase o Hex, IDEs o superficies de chat como Slack. La integración nativa con tu almacén de datos, el control de versiones y las herramientas de colaboración del equipo importa más que una demo vistosa.
Mejores herramientas de IA para consultas SQL
AI2SQL
AI2SQL convierte prompts en lenguaje natural a SQL en varios dialectos y está orientada a usuarios que nunca han escrito una consulta. El nivel freemium cubre generaciones básicas y una API, lo que facilita integrarla en paneles internos o bots de soporte cuando el acceso ad-hoc no es suficiente.
Coginiti
Coginiti se posiciona como un co-desarrollador de IA para equipos de analítica, ofreciendo asistencia inteligente a las consultas, recomendaciones de rendimiento y componentes reutilizables. Brilla en entornos colaborativos donde el estilo de SQL consistente, la documentación y las buenas prácticas compartidas importan tanto como la velocidad pura de generación.
Analyst Intelligence
Analyst Intelligence se centra específicamente en Google BigQuery, lo cual es su fortaleza y su limitación. Los analistas no técnicos pueden describir una pregunta y recibir SQL de BigQuery que respeta las funciones específicas del almacén, encajando en un flujo de trabajo de datos nativo de GCP ya existente.
Blaze SQL
Blaze SQL se dirige al mismo público de «inglés a SQL» que AI2SQL, pero se inclina hacia planes de pago orientados a negocio con controles de privacidad más sólidos. Es una opción práctica para equipos que necesitan una herramienta lista para usar en lugar de una API que integrar por su cuenta.
Genie - AI Data Assistant
Genie va un paso más allá de la generación de SQL al permitir que los usuarios de negocio consulten y visualicen datos sin escribir código. La salida suele ser un gráfico o una tabla, con el SQL disponible por detrás, lo que lo hace útil para el autoservicio de los stakeholders.
Hex.tech
Hex Magic es la capa de IA dentro del entorno de notebooks de Hex, que genera SQL, Python y gráficos a partir de un prompt en contexto. Es una buena opción para analistas que ya viven en notebooks y quieren un lugar unificado para consultar, transformar y visualizar sin cambiar de herramienta.
Metabot AI
Metabot AI vive dentro de Metabase, la popular herramienta de BI de código abierto, por lo que cualquier equipo que ya use Metabase puede hacer preguntas en lenguaje natural y obtener respuestas respaldadas por SQL. Para quienes ya usan Metabase, es el camino de menor resistencia hacia las consultas asistidas por IA.
QueryBox
QueryBox se encarga de la larga cola de archivos: Excel, CSV e incluso PDFs, para que los usuarios no técnicos puedan hacer preguntas sin tener que cargar los datos en un almacén. Es ideal para preguntas de negocio ad-hoc en las que montar un pipeline es excesivo.
DataLang
DataLang convierte una base de datos conectada en un asistente potenciado por GPT sin necesidad de programar. Lo apuntas a una fuente de datos y expone una superficie de chat que puede responder preguntas, ejecutar consultas y devolver resúmenes fundamentados en tus datos reales.
Fabi.ai
Fabi.ai combina SQL, Python y automatización en un único espacio de trabajo de analítica, lo cual resulta útil cuando una pregunta requiere más que una sola consulta. Los equipos la utilizan para análisis en varios pasos donde la generación, la transformación y las actualizaciones programadas son importantes.
FluentHQ
FluentHQ se presenta como un analista de datos con IA, permitiendo a los usuarios de negocio autoservirse respuestas mediante lenguaje natural sobre su almacén de datos. El punto de entrada freemium la hace accesible para equipos que están probando BI impulsado por IA antes de comprometerse con una plataforma mayor.
Jam SQL Studio
Jam SQL Studio es un IDE de SQL potenciado por IA con soporte multi-base de datos, asistencia inteligente de codificación y gestión de esquemas integrada. Atrae a ingenieros y analistas que quieren un espacio de trabajo dedicado en lugar de una herramienta tipo chat, con la IA como compañero de programación.
Cómo elegir
Elige Analyst Intelligence, Metabot AI o Hex.tech si ya estás comprometido con un almacén o herramienta de BI específica. Para experiencias puras de «inglés a SQL» orientadas a usuarios no técnicos, AI2SQL, Blaze SQL, DataLang y FluentHQ son los puntos de partida naturales. Los ingenieros y analistas que buscan un entorno centrado en código deberían mirar Coginiti o Jam SQL Studio. Cuando los datos viven en hojas de cálculo en lugar de en un almacén, QueryBox es la opción más directa, y Genie o Fabi.ai encajan en equipos que necesitan visualización más rica o análisis en varios pasos por encima.
Preguntas frecuentes
¿Puede la IA escribir SQL correcto a partir de lenguaje natural?
Para preguntas bien definidas contra un esquema conocido, las herramientas modernas de IA para SQL son muy precisas. Los casos límite —nombres de columna ambiguos, joins complejos o lógica de negocio no documentada— siguen requiriendo un revisor humano, por eso las mejores herramientas muestran la consulta generada y explican la lógica.
¿Son seguras las herramientas de IA para SQL en bases de datos de producción?
Las herramientas de confianza se conectan con credenciales de solo lectura por defecto y requieren que apruebes o edites la consulta antes de ejecutarla. Para datos sensibles, busca cumplimiento de SOC 2 o equivalente, registros de auditoría y la capacidad de restringir el acceso por rol o entorno.
¿Estas herramientas funcionan con mi dialecto de SQL?
La mayoría soporta los principales dialectos de fábrica, incluidos Postgres, MySQL, BigQuery, Snowflake y SQL Server. Confirma siempre el soporte de dialecto antes de adoptar una herramienta, sobre todo si dependes de funciones específicas del almacén como UNNEST de BigQuery o FLATTEN de Snowflake.
¿Sustituirá la IA a los analistas de datos?
La IA se entiende mejor como un multiplicador de fuerza. Elimina las partes tediosas de escribir y depurar SQL para que los analistas puedan dedicar más tiempo a formular preguntas, validar resultados y dar forma al modelo de datos —trabajos que las herramientas aún no hacen bien—.
¿Cómo evalúo una herramienta de IA para SQL antes de implantarla?
Empieza con un conjunto pequeño de preguntas reales que tu equipo hace repetidamente y compara la salida de la herramienta con SQL escrito a mano en cuanto a precisión, rendimiento y claridad. Involucra tanto a ingenieros como a usuarios de negocio, y haz un piloto con acceso de solo lectura sobre un dataset de pruebas antes del uso en producción.
Las mejores herramientas de IA para consultas SQL comparten una promesa común: reducir el coste de hacer una pregunta de datos. Tanto si eres un desarrollador que intenta acelerar la generación de scaffolding como un marketer que busca autoservirse respuestas, la herramienta adecuada convierte SQL de guardián en utilidad. Empieza con las fuentes de datos en las que ya confías, haz un piloto con un conjunto de preguntas concreto y amplía una vez que el flujo de trabajo se sienta fiable.